Weapons, fake arms licences seized

Published February 21, 2003

KOHAT, Feb 20: The Kohat police seized automatic weapons and 13 fake arms licences from four persons travelling in a Karachi-bound coach on the Indus Highway near Lachi Town on Wednesday.

During a routine search of a Peshawar-Karachi coach (GA-9546), the police recovered three rifles of 44 bore, three pistols and 140 cartridges from Mehmood and Mohammad Baksh, residents of Sukkur, and Mehr Ali and Allah Din, residents of Khairpur.

SHO Rasheed Khan after registering a case handed over the accused to the investigation department.
